K - ONE YEAR LATER
CHAPTER 12: THE WORLD OF THE FUTURE (BY RAIRAKU REI)

Translation: Naru-kun Raws: Ridia
A year has passed since then.
Shiro, the man who is Isana Yashiro, and Adolf K. Weismann remembered the landscape of that day's sunrise many times.
The dawn of that day, when the old friend of his who had been carrying out the dream he had started passed away.
(Weismann... what a beautiful new world!)
On the bridge of the "Schattenreich", Daikaku Kokujoji said that with a trembling throat. Outside the window, the sun appeared from beyond the sea of ​​clouds, trying to illuminate the world.
(Someday I dreamed of a view like this.)
Having lived as the greatest "King", he was looking at the dawn light at the moment when his life ran out.
(It's a shame to close your eyes...)
Those were his last words.
The airship "Schattenreich", the place where Kokujoji passed away, is now moored on the rooftop of Mihashira Tower.
On the bridge of the "Schattenreich", Shiro was reflecting on the sunrise sight that he had witnessed with Kokujoji.
"Silver King."
An old "rabbit" quietly appeared and said to Shiro.
"Munakata Reisi came to see you."
"Yes."
As Shiro nodded, the "Rabbit" quietly withdrew, and Munakata in a blue uniform appeared with the sound of his shoes echoing.
Shiro smiled brightly.
"Hello, Munakata-san, it's been a while. How was your trip?"
Shiro was informed in advance that Munakata would be traveling for a while, and he consulted and took countermeasures for any inconvenience that might arise in his absence.
A short time ago, he received the news of his return and a request to meet him. He felt somewhat ominous from the fact that it was the day he had just finished maintenance on the "Schattenreich".
"It was very significant. What are you doing with this airship? Do you want to go on a journey with me?"
"No way."
Shiro laughed and said that.
"I will no longer leave the ground."
Shiro narrowed his eyes as he looked inside the airship, which had the same structure as the "Himmelreich" where he had spent almost 70 years.
"This airship was unreasonably torn to shreds during the decisive battle with "Jungle" a year ago, and I left it as it was, but I was finally able to repair it. I have no intention of flying anywhere anymore, but the Lieutenant took care of it for a long time, so I want to restore it to its beautiful appearance before I put it to sleep."
"I see."
Munakata agreed with a slight smile on his lips.
"Munakata-san, have you finished your journey?"
"Yes. I have found the answer and the many encounters I have had along the way have given me a new idea of what to do."
"I see. I want to hear about the world you've seen, Munakata-san."
"I decided that I should talk to you, so I came here."
Just when he thought this was going to be a long story, several young "rabbits" arrived with chairs, a small table, and tea utensils. He couldn't help but smile bitterly at those who were too smart.
Grateful, he sat on the chair that had been prepared for him and listened to the story of Munakata's journey while he drank tea.
Munakata's story was like an adventure tale that children would enjoy, like a presentation of research results at an academic conference, or like a philosophical murmuring.
Shiro listened carefully to Munakata's story, interspersing questions from time to time.
How people around the world live, think and act. It was a time to experience the situation of people living, through Munakata, which cannot be covered by the news.
"Even if it's not as strong as in Japan where the "Slate" was, the effects of the release of the "Slate" are still being felt all over the world."
"Because there aren't as many people with persistent supernatural powers as in Japan, the situation is even more difficult for people with supernatural powers around the world than in Japan."
Shiro put his hand on his chin and thought. Munakata looked directly at Shiro through the back of his glasses.
"You could say that humanity has taken a new step forward. Aren't you responsible for that, Weismann?"
Instead of an accusing tone, Munakata spoke in a calm and determined voice.
In the depths of Shiro's eyes, the dawn of that day shone again.
The night is over. A new world has begun. The scene that Claudia and Kokujoji dreamed of in the past may be a little different now, but when morning comes, they have to get up and start walking.
"Of course."
Shiro nodded.
"I am responsible. I had a dream about the "Slate" and I was responsible for moving it. I was responsible for giving Nagare Hisui's dream that effect. So I will do my best. I can no longer be a person who only dreams and prays. I listen to people's prayers and I will do my best to bring them closer to a world where those prayers come true. I think that's my job."
"Very good."
Munakata nodded in satisfaction and stood up.
"I will do my best as well. As a leader who walks in front of the people, even though I am no longer the "King" determined by the "Slate". As the head of "Scepter 4". As a person named Reisi Munakata. There is no no cloud in our cause."
Munakata turned around and left the "Schattenreich".
Shiro stared at the space where Munakata had left for a while, pondered what he should do, and slowly sat up.
The "rabbits" appeared and waited by Shiro's side as if they were waiting for their lives.
"Please inform me about this airship."
"Ok."
"And… once again, thanks for coming back."
A year ago, Shiro relieved the "rabbits" of their responsibilities. According to Kokujoji's will, they were to help Shiro until he returned to the surface. After that, they disappeared into the shadows, just trying to maintain the system established by Kokujoji.
However, they went back to work for Shiro. There were many things that he could not have done without the "rabbits".
The old "rabbit" bowed deeply.
"You are his successor in will. It is our deepest desire to serve you."
"Thank you.", Shiro said again.
Under the transparent floor there was nothing anymore, where the "Slate" was before, Shiro said goodbye to the "Schattenreich".

About “TEMPELHOF 1945”
This story has important meaning as an indicator why Yashichiro Takahashi (Black) introduced 'Himmelreich' and 'Schattenreich' idea through airship each named on.
Recognition deference of "King" between Adolf and Kokujoji has been shown in the storyline, later it links to the introduction scene in SIDE:GREEN (Novel), portrayed as a confrontation between Kokujoji and Hisui Nagare .
[Summary]
After Claudia Weisman’s death in Dresden bombing.
Adolf awoke as “Silver King” by the bombing / Sister’s death. (? vague description)
Kokujoji tried to make Adolf aware as “the king”, strongly requested his govern along king’s responsibility with superhuman power. However Adolf denied it for depression of his sister's death.
Kokujoji felt Adolf's denial was same as 'spoiled child' attitude, one the other, Kokujoji was well perceiving the meaning of 'to be a king' would be a journey to Hell - as lonely bearer of mankind's hatred and grudge.
Adolf's denial might not be accepted because the power was already activated with unstable danger, Kokujoji decided to kill Adolf with a gun for his relief, but it failed that Adolf blocked by the shield emerged under his unconscious.
Then Kokujoji and Adolf realized/confirmed a feature of the power that Adolf awaken was 'immortality'.
Leaking of 'Koenig Project' -the name that Weismann and Kokjoji were researching the slate- from German insider to Allies, Dresden bombing was occurred. Allies also intended to get some information of the project, Adolf was abducted by US Commando during Kokujoji absence in Beriln.
Commando took Adolf and escaped to mountain area in south central Germany.
Kokujoji reported the incident to Presidential office, succeeded to mobilize six companies from Heer, soon started chasing Commando.
Adolf, restrained by handcuffs, didn't try to escape by own, was just taken around with resistless mind, immersed himself in loop of reflection since the muzzle pointed by Kokujoji. Adolf wanted to believe in "rex" power that they could find a 'Methode' for 'Freude' of mankind, not a journey to Hell.
Commando soldiers were cornered and irritated for encirclement by Heer. Chief asked Adolf with expectation of his knowledge as a local people to search a place 30 members of Commando would be able to hide until Heer pass by, Adolf agreed. In that time, one of solider said "If only his sister survived, we would have a joy hiding time." Insulting Claudia was unforgivable, Adolf silently got furious, felt hatred, his power seeped out as enigmatic pressure to them. Sooner it was settled, but enough to give them fear.
Hiding Commando was a good target as Kokujoji expected. Under the proxy of annihilation with no recommendation to surrender from Presidential Office, Kokujoji and Heer carried out artillery barrage. Only Kokujoji had grasped Adolf's immortality. He bet on Adolf's decision to be the king in their danger, then fired.
During attacked, Adolf did not help Commando soldiers for his hatred mind. If he had tried them to be his 'clansman', they would had been able to survive, but he didn't and let them die. Adolf asked himself what was "a 'Methode' for 'Freude' of mankind" which he aspired. He shed tears and deeply despaired against himself.
Kokujoji found out Adolf alone before being secured by Heer, where he left the barrage area and was wondering around. Letting Adolf back to Berlin with no accusing, but Kokujoji just gave one question when after rescued - he made onigiri and served it Adolf fasted for several days - "Did you find some 'Methode' for 'Freude'?" (* This section supplemented in "K THE FIRST STORY by Rei Rairaku(Pink))
'Koenig Project' was completely dumped, nobody care of the slate would be sent to Japan by Kokujoji. Preparing for carrying out, Kokujoji and his man were going to move the slate from Tempelhof airport to Keel naval port. Also at the same time, Adolf was going to board his airship 'Himmelreich' and get out from his country from Tempelhof.
Before parting ways, Adolf asked Kokujoji that he really would be a king. Kokujoji replied the slate activation never stop and somebody would do for his/her unknown purpose if he dumped again. So he should be a king with controlling the slate for a better future. Adolf realized own despair against himself and his doubt for the king's power would become a hindrance for Kokujoji's way. Adolf perfectly gave up all the options for his life, said "For me, everything is over." But Kokujoji hadn't given up. " Let me ask you one last time, " he asked to go with, "Farewell here, Lieutenant.", Adolf replied as if to discontinue then step forward to board 'Himmelreich'.
"You do really escape, Weismann?" Finally Kokujoji threw his word which stabbed Adolf's mind for a long time after this. Adolf never looked back, flew off the ground and disappeared.
[Note]
In original Japanese text by Black-san, we feel his expression is bit metaphorical and we have to read over each word carefully. (Sometime non-description has important meaning on underplot which will be related later.)
In this "TEMPELHOF 1945", timeline and composition are back and forth, make us confuse if we do not memorize the timeline what episodes originally are. So I lined up along their timeline in summary above.
I think there are some points requested to image for reading this episode as below.
There are concepts of Heaven and Hell throughout the story for describing of two character, Adolf and Kokujoji. (It takes over in the series thereafter)
Adolf's 'Immortality' haven't confirmed until Kokujoji would try to shoot Adolf.
Presidential Office accepted including A.K.Weismann would be killed in annihilation operation. Kokujoji took advantage of the operation as like, to let Adolf be the king by setting him in danger, to be free him from "Koenig Project" itself.
Despair with self-denial in Adolf himself is figured out as 'Isana Yashiro'. (Potentially avoid in Adolf's appearance, especially against Kokujoji up to K7S:CV)
